Key Skills or Qualifications Required

To stand out in the competitive job market, aspiring teachers should focus on acquiring the following skills and qualifications:

  • TEFL/TESOL certification
  • Experience in international curricula (e.g., IB, Cambridge)
  • Strong communication and cultural adaptability skills
  • Proficiency in English and basic Vietnamese (optional but beneficial)

Steps to Get Started

Embarking on a teaching career in Ho Chi Minh City requires careful planning and preparation. Here are the steps to get started:

  1. Obtain relevant teaching certifications and qualifications.
  2. Gain experience in international teaching environments.
  3. Research and apply to international schools in Ho Chi Minh City.
  4. Prepare for interviews by understanding the school’s culture and values.

Challenges and How to Overcome Them

Teaching in a foreign country comes with its set of challenges, such as cultural differences and language barriers. To overcome these, consider the following strategies:

  • Engage in cultural exchange programs to better understand local customs.
  • Take language classes to improve communication with students and colleagues.
  • Network with other international teachers for support and advice.
